These two attractive, well maintained and furnished holiday cottages, were once fishermen’s cottages. Backed by a shared courtyard, they lie in the heart of the quaint and interesting fishing town of Sheringham, noted for its crabs and shellfish. Immediate access to many of the resort’s selection of attractive inns, restaurants and diverse shops. The beaches at Sheringham and West Runton are excellent for bathing, and the area is well known for its fine golf courses. There is excellent sailing, wind-surfing and bird watching areas are within easy driving distance. The steam railway at Sheringham offers regular trips to Weybourne and Holt throughout the summer. Cromer, most of this coastline has been designated an AONB by the NT, so it almost goes without saying that there is stunning scenery galore. Wildlife conservation is extremely important here, and bird enthusiasts in particular will find the sanctuaries at Morston Marshes and Blakeney Point (both NT) provide an interesting and alternative way, to spend the day amidst nature.
